What Is Creatine?
Creatine is a substance found naturally in muscle cells. It helps your muscles produce energy during heavy lifting or high-intensity exercise. People often take creatine as a dietary supplement.
It is made from three amino acids: glycine, arginine, and methionine. The body produces it, but you can also get it from foods like red meat and seafood.
- Found in muscle cells
- Helps produce energy
- Made from amino acids
- Available in foods and supplements

Types Of Whey Protein
There are three main types of whey protein. Each type has different uses and benefits.
- Whey Protein Concentrate:Contains some fat and lactose. It is cheaper and good for general use.
- Whey Protein Isolate:Has more protein and less fat. It is faster to digest and good for lean muscle.
- Whey Protein Hydrolysate:Pre-digested for quick absorption. It may reduce allergy risks.

Recommended Dosages
The usual creatine dose is 3 to 5 grams per day. Whey protein doses vary but often range from 20 to 30 grams per serving.
Stick to these amounts to avoid stomach discomfort and get the best results.
- Creatine: 3-5 grams daily
- Whey protein: 20-30 grams per shake

Myth: Creatine Causes Dehydration
Some say creatine makes you dehydrated because it draws water into muscles. This is not true for most people.
Studies show creatine does not cause dehydration or heat illness. Drinking enough water is important with any supplement.
- Creatine pulls water into muscle cells, not away from the body
- Proper hydration prevents dehydration regardless of creatine use
- Many athletes use creatine safely without dehydration issues

Can Creatine And Whey Protein Be Taken Together Safely?
Yes, creatine and whey protein can be safely mixed and consumed together. They complement each other well for muscle growth and recovery. Many athletes combine them post-workout for better results. There are no known adverse interactions between these supplements.
Does Mixing Creatine With Whey Improve Muscle Gains?
Combining creatine with whey protein can enhance muscle gains. Creatine boosts strength and power, while whey provides essential amino acids for repair. Together, they support faster recovery and increased muscle mass. This combination is popular among fitness enthusiasts for effective results.
When Is The Best Time To Mix Creatine With Whey Protein?
The best time to mix creatine with whey protein is immediately after workouts. This timing helps maximize nutrient absorption and muscle recovery. Post-workout consumption replenishes energy stores and supports muscle repair effectively. Taking them together saves time and improves convenience.
Will Mixing Creatine With Whey Cause Stomach Issues?
Mixing creatine with whey protein generally does not cause stomach issues. However, some individuals may experience mild discomfort if taken in large doses. Start with small amounts and increase gradually. Drinking plenty of water can also help reduce any digestive discomfort.
